I think the general beef people have with them is:

1) their constant sales of every imaginable poster as a repro has hurt sales of real posters 2) when you go to fleaBay and do searches, you get 5million MG listings of repros, and it's like being spammed.. takes lots of time to wade through.. wasting buyer's time
3) they've screwed people whom have consigned stuff to them as well as buyers

usually things like that result in animosity
